The Rise of Apache Parquet A Game-Changer for Data Storage and Analytics
In the era of big data, the way we store and analyze information has become crucial in deriving actionable insights and driving business success. Among various data storage formats, Apache Parquet has emerged as a popular choice, especially when dealing with large datasets. Its efficient columnar storage and compatibility with numerous data processing frameworks make it a game-changer for data engineers and analysts alike.

Another significant advantage of Parquet is its support for advanced compression techniques. The format offers various compression algorithms such as Snappy, Gzip, and LZ4, which help in reducing the storage footprint of the data. This not only leads to cost savings when storing vast amounts of information but also improves the efficiency of data transfer across networks. The combination of columnar storage and advanced compression makes Parquet well-suited for cloud storage solutions, which are often cost-sensitive.

The versatility of Apache Parquet is further amplified by its compatibility with multiple programming languages and tools. It can be effectively utilized in languages like Python, Java, and Scala, making it accessible to a wide range of data professionals. Moreover, Parquet files can seamlessly integrate with popular big data processing frameworks, creating a cohesive ecosystem for data analytics. Data scientists can easily read and write Parquet files using libraries like PyArrow and Pandas, enhancing their workflow and productivity.
In addition to performance and flexibility, Parquet also includes built-in support for schema evolution. This means that as data requirements change, users can adapt their datasets without significant overhead. Parquet files can store metadata about the schema, including field names and data types, which helps maintain the integrity of the data even as it evolves over time.
